<a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/category/allods-online/"><em>Allods Online's</em></a> mascots are back for <a href="http://allods.gpotato.com/news/2012/05/13/the-troll-crab-continue-their-adventures/">another humorous video</a>, as Troll and Crab try their hands (claws) at making potions. It doesn't quite go as expected, but it's hard to blame Crab for what happens (he's just an earnest little guy). This is all to promote the game's newest update, patch 3.0.2, which promises to be a savory concoction for players to quaff. Over the weekend, <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/tag/gpotato/">gPotato</a> <a href="http://allods.gpotato.com/minisite/">opened up a new mini-site</a> to promote the update and has since posted several new articles highlighting the changes.<br />
<br />
Some of patch 3.0.2's big selling points include <a href="http://allods.gpotato.com/news/2012/05/11/patch-3-0-02-preview-new-alchemy-system/">a revamp</a> of the Alchemy profession, the ability for <a href="http://allods.gpotato.com/news/2012/05/11/patch-3-0-02-preview-new-alchemy-system/">pets to do the looting</a>, a neat-sounding <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/2012/04/30/allods-onlines-patch-3-0-1-bringing-mentor-system-new-astral-s/">mentor system</a>, a new skirmish called <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/2012/04/27/allods-online-to-add-questing-features-new-skirmish-and-raid-b/">The Deserted Farm</a>, a <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/2012/04/30/allods-onlines-patch-3-0-1-bringing-mentor-system-new-astral-s/">free-for-all treasure hunting space</a>, a new <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/2012/04/27/allods-online-to-add-questing-features-new-skirmish-and-raid-b/">raid boss</a>, and <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/2012/04/27/allods-online-to-add-questing-features-new-skirmish-and-raid-b/">better questing</a>.<br />

<a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/category/perpetuum"><em>Perpetuum</em></a> turns one year old this week, and the devs at <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/tag/avatar-creations">Avatar Creations</a> are celebrating in style. A new blog entry brings word of an anniversary weekend complete with a competitive PvP tournament and a not-so-competitive treasure hunt.<br />
<br />
The tourney happens on the weekend of December 3rd, and it's open only to corporations (few solo players could afford the 10 million NIC entry fee anyway). In terms of format, the event is a 16-team ladder elimination affair, and the first 16 corporations to mail in their registration fee will be accepted (the deadline is November 27th).<br />
<br />
If your group isn't up for bloodletting and robotic mayhem, you can join in the PvE treasure hunt and obtain plenty of loot rewards for your trouble. The world's most epic love story is coming to a close, a treasure map is discovered, and celebrations galore are on the way. It's not a soap opera; it's Episode 6 for <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/tag/trickster-online/"><em>Trickster Online</em></a>, which has landed on the servers today.<br />
<br />
<em>Trickster's </em>latest update features the final part of its current story arc as well as a heapload of new content for players to explore. The episode adds 23 additional areas to the game, 56 more quests, an escort system, and a treasure hunt for billionaire Don Cavalier's loot.<br />
<br />
<a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/tag/sg-interactive/">SG Interactive's</a> <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/tag/chris-lee/">Chris Lee</a> says to look at Episode 6 not as an ending but as a new beginning: "The new episode will put the finishing touch to our storyline while providing engaging contents for all players, from beginners to high level players. In addition to concluding the current storyline, this update marks the beginning of more new adventures in <em>Trickster Online</em>, and players should anticipate big celebrations in and out of the game coming soon."<br />

Lots of stuff is going on in the world of Agon, and the weekend brought us a double-shot of news updates, one good and one not so good. <a href="http://www.aventurine.gr/">Aventurine's</a> Tasos Flambouras recently checked in on the official boards to announce a delay on the <a href="http://forums.darkfallonline.com/showthread.php?p=4499661#post4499661">upcoming expansion</a>. The delay appears to be primarily performance-related. "<em>The expansion is forced back a short while longer, we hope no longer than a couple of weeks, in order to get the performance right, and everything in the expansion working properly and tested thoroughly so there's no repeat of the last setback with the terrain feature</em>," he wrote. <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/tag/aventurine">Aventurine</a> has also been having trouble with its network service provider, and the post provides a few details along those lines as well.<br />
<br />
Now for the good news: <a href="http://forums.darkfallonline.com/showthread.php?t=260421">treasure hunting</a> is coming to <a href="http://www.darkfallonline.com"><em>Darkfall</em></a>, courtesy of the aforementioned expansion. Players will be able to acquire map-reading skills from NPCs, make their own shovels to unearth various objects, and use treasure map hints to determine appropriate dig locations. "<em>We are already planning on expanding this system, which means you can expect additional treasure hunt features being added on top of the one we talked about today</em>," writes Aventurine's Laenih on the <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/category/darkfall"><em>Darkfall</em></a> forums.<p style="padding:5px;background:#ffffcc;border:1px solid #ffff99;clear:both;"><a href="http://massively.joystiq.com"><img src="http://massively.joystiq.com/media/feedlogo.gif" alt="Massively" style="float:left;padding:0 5px 5px 0;" /></a><a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/2010/09/12/darkfall-expansion-delayed-treasure-hunting-in-the-works/">Darkfall expansion delayed, treasure hunting in the works</a> originally appeared on <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com">Massively</a> on Sun, 12 Sep 2010 20:00:00 EST. <a href="http://www.funcom.com">Funcom</a> executive producer Craig "Silirrion" Morrison has returned with his monthly <a href="http://forums.ageofconan.com/showthread.php?p=2844165">development update</a>, and the August edition features a fair number of juicy tidbits regarding new <a href="http://www.ageofconan.com"><em>Age of Conan</em></a> content coming this Fall. In addition to the Dreamworld game engine update, fans of <a href="http://massively.joystiq.com/tag/funcom">Funcom's</a> Hyboria can look forward to a new 12-on-12 PvP minigame, new PvE zones, additional raid content, and social/guild content.<br />
<br />
The new PvE zones will open up in Khitai's Pai Kang, and will take the form of two new districts in the imperial capital city. Raid content will include additional Tier 4 instances with three new encounters, as well as further additions that Morrison says may or may not make it into the Fall update package. Finally, new guild city NPCs will allow members to host social events including treasure hunts, demon hunts, and storytelling competitions. Players will also be able to sign up for horse racing, and top tier guilds will gain access to an exclusive area on the rooftops of Old Tarantia.<br />
